Heavy Flood Inflow Continues into Srisailam Reservoir

Due to heavy rainfall in Karnataka and Maharashtra, the Krishna River is witnessing strong flood flow. As a result, large volumes of water are entering Srisailam Reservoir from Sunkesula and Jurala projects. Currently, the inflow from these projects into Srisailam is 1,27,392 cusecs, while the outflow from Srisailam stands at 1,40,009 cusecs.

Water is being released to Nagarjuna Sagar through two spillway gates, with a flow of 53,764 cusecs. Additionally, 20,000 cusecs is being released through the Pothireddypadu head regulator, 35,315 cusecs through the left canal power station, and 30,930 cusecs through the right canal power station.

The Full Reservoir Level (FRL) of Srisailam is 885 feet, and the current water level is 882.40 feet. The total water storage capacity of the reservoir is 215.80 TMC, and it currently holds 201.12 TMC.
